UPDATE: 2000 ITR #451
Car has not been recovered, and still missing since AUG 3rd..
Insurance is still in process, spoke to a claim adjuster 2 weeks after it was stolen and now its a waiting period, another words going through investigations. Minimum for auto theft w/o recovery is 90 days. GD.
Currently its day 45 w/o my baby and i surely miss the VTEC band.

GOOD NEWS: 1 out 4 claims has paided up. Lojack check for $595.00 came in the mail today 9/15. 3 to go.

BAD NEWS: what to get that is in the $20-30K price range w/o breaking the piggy bank. Any suggestions?

So far IS300, BMW 3s, 2003 Z 350, S2000 is a $30K price tag, that means $10K down, $20K owe ouch... wallet not approved.
